Authored by 毕凯

PHP 错误修改

... ... @@ -10,9 +10,9 @@ class Helpers
/**
* 构建网站的URL
*
*
* 备注:所有的URL构建都尽量使用该方法,便于以后维护.
*
*
* @param string $uri 如 "/passport/reg/index"
* @param array $param 参数项 array(key1 => value1, key2 => value2,),默认为array()
* @param string $module 模块名 如"index"表示默认, "guang"表示逛,"list"表示商品列表,"search"表示搜索
... ... @@ -53,7 +53,7 @@ class Helpers
/**
* 根据尺寸获得图片url
*
*
* @param string $url 路径
* @param integer $width 图片宽度
* @param integer $height 图片高度
... ... @@ -80,7 +80,7 @@ class Helpers
/**
* 获取过滤APP里附加参数后的URL链接
*
*
* @param string $url 路径
* @return string 去除掉如&openby:yohobuy={"action":"go.brand"}这样的APP附加参数
*/
... ... @@ -97,7 +97,7 @@ class Helpers
/**
* 根据用户访问的COOKIE判断出性别
*
*
* @return string
*/
public static function getGenderByCookie()
... ... @@ -115,7 +115,7 @@ class Helpers
/**
* 根据用户访问的COOKIE判断出频道
*
*
* @return int
*/
public static function getChannelByCookie()
... ... @@ -137,7 +137,7 @@ class Helpers
/**
* 从用户加入购物车的COOKIE取出购物车凭证
*
*
* @return string
*/
public static function getShoppingKeyByCookie()
... ... @@ -148,7 +148,7 @@ class Helpers
/**
* 获取商品的ICON
*
*
* @param int $type
* @return array
*/
... ... @@ -209,7 +209,7 @@ class Helpers
/**
* 格式化商品信息
*
*
* @param array $productData 需要格式化的商品数据
* @param bool $showTags 控制是否显示标签
* @param bool $showNew 控制是否显示NEW图标
... ... @@ -233,7 +233,7 @@ class Helpers
}
// 判别默认的商品是否将默认的图片URL赋值到skn
$flag = false;
$flag = false;
// 如果设置了默认图片,就取默认的图片
foreach ($productData['goods_list'] as $oneGoods) {
// 此skc是默认的,则将图片赋值给skn
... ... @@ -297,11 +297,11 @@ class Helpers
}
/**
* 根据性别来决定 默认图片获取字段 如果是 2、3
*
* 根据性别来决定 默认图片获取字段 如果是 2、3
*
* 则优先从cover2 --》 cover1 -- 》 images_url
* 否则优先从cover1 --》 cover2 -- 》 images_url
*
*
* @param array $images
* @return string 商品图片
*/
... ... @@ -320,7 +320,7 @@ class Helpers
/**
* 格式化资讯文章
*
*
* @param array $articleData 需要格式化的资讯数据
* @param bool $showTag 是否显示左上角标签
* @param mixed $isApp 是否显示分享,在APP客户端里嵌入需要传url链接
... ... @@ -395,7 +395,7 @@ class Helpers
/**
* 格式化广告焦点图数据
*
*
* @param array $bannerData 需要格式化的广告图数据
* @param int $width 图片的宽度
* @param int $height 图片的高度
... ... @@ -417,7 +417,7 @@ class Helpers
/**
* 生成公开的TOKEN凭证
*
*
* @param string $string 字符串
* @return string
*/
... ... @@ -428,7 +428,7 @@ class Helpers
/**
* 验证TOKEN凭证
*
*
* @param string $string 字符串
* @param string $token 公开访问TOKEN
* @return bool
... ... @@ -444,7 +444,7 @@ class Helpers
/**
* 验证手机是否合法
*
*
* @param int $mobile
* @return boolean
*/
... ... @@ -458,7 +458,7 @@ class Helpers
/**
* 验证密码是否合法
*
*
* @param int $password
* @return boolean
*/
... ... @@ -472,7 +472,7 @@ class Helpers
/**
* 验证邮箱是否合法
*
*
* @param string $email
* @return boolean
*/
... ... @@ -485,8 +485,8 @@ class Helpers
}
/**
* 验证国际手机号是否合法
*
* 验证国际手机号是否合法
*
* @param string $areaMobile
* @return boolean
*/
... ... @@ -513,7 +513,7 @@ class Helpers
*
* @return string 处理之后的地址
*/
public static function transUrl($url, $channel='woman')
public static function transUrl($url, $channel='woman')
{
$extra = '';
if(!empty($url) && stripos($url, '?') === false) {
... ... @@ -524,8 +524,8 @@ class Helpers
}
return $url . $extra;
}
/**
* 各国手机号规则
*/
... ... @@ -585,7 +585,7 @@ class Helpers
/**
* 格式化订单商品
*
*
* @param array $orderGoods 订单
* @param int $count 计订单件数
* @param bool $haveLink 控制是否需要商品链接
... ... @@ -693,7 +693,7 @@ class Helpers
* @param int $count 计商品件数
* @return array $arr 处理之后的加价购商品数据
*/
public static function formatAdvanceGoods($advanceGoods, &$count = 0)
public static function formatAdvanceGoods($advanceGoods, $isGift = false, &$count = 0)
{
$arr = array();
... ... @@ -728,7 +728,7 @@ class Helpers
return $arr;
}
/**
* 订单状态,按订单支付类型和订单状态
* @var array
... ... @@ -777,7 +777,7 @@ class Helpers
/**
* 获取会员的级别
*
*
* @param string $vipInfo
* @return int
*/
... ... @@ -815,10 +815,10 @@ class Helpers
}
return '//item.yohobuy.com/product/pro_' . $product_id . '_' . $goods_id . '/' . $cn_alphabet. '.html';
}
/**
* 获取真实IP
*
*
* @return string
*/
public static function getClientIp()
... ... @@ -832,8 +832,8 @@ class Helpers
$ip = $_SERVER['REMOTE_ADDR'];
return $ip;
}
/**
/**
* 组合国际手机号
* @param $area
* @param $mobile
... ...